Horse Vaulting Breed. vaulting enjoys an ancient heritage and can probably be described as one of the oldest known forms of equestrian sport. the american vaulting association, or ava, claims vaulting is the safest equestrian sport. horse vaulting encompasses various types, including individual vaulting, pas de deux (pairs vaulting), and team vaulting, each presenting distinct. Popular breeds used include the american quarter horse, morgan, thoroughbred, and appaloosa. a vaulting ‘team’ is made up of a horse, a lunger (or longeur, who controls the horse), and one or more vaulter (sometimes known as gymnasts or athletes). Many of the maneuvers are carried out at a canter although when practicing they’re often performed at a walk. great vaulting horses can be found in nearly every breed and among grade (mixed breed) horses. Although a horse must be strong physically to succeed in vaulting, their temperament is an equally important factor.
